Superior Tool Technology Inc
3600 19 st ne #3 T2E6V2 Calgary Alberta Canada
- Profile: Superior Tool Technology Inc is a Industrial and Commercial Machinery and Computer E company located at Calgary, Alberta Canada, address is 3600 19 st ne #3, Calgary T2E6V2 AB, postcode is T2E6V2, you can contact Superior Tool Technology Inc by phone 4032914181